Nine stared at the ceiling of the thatched roof hut that was now his home in a dazed-like state. 

This was wrong. 

He was wrong.

The body he wore was too small. He was short, his hands were tiny, and he was weak.

He was...

He was...

He was a child, or at least, he was in the body of one. 

Nine remembered being left behind. The planet was set to detonate and he held the bomb. His teammates were long gone, their missions completed. 

He was unwilling, but there was nothing to be done. It was over in a blink of an eye. 

And now he found himself here. 

Staring at the ceiling of a thatched roof hut.

In the body of a child. 

"Toby, is everything alright?" 

There was a woman standing over him with a worried gaze. 

Her hair was white, and her skin was like copper. Her eyes were a warm brown, softened with kindness and lined by shadows. 

Nine was charmed, and unfamiliar emotion welled up inside him. 

"Toby?" 

Nine stared at her. 

She stared back. 

Slowly, he nodded, the movement not unlike a doll. 

The woman pursed her lips and kneeled down beside him.

She reached toward him, and Nine instinctively flinched away. 

There was suddenly a look of distress on the woman's face. 

"Toby, please. I need to check the wound." 

It was then that Nine realized there were bandages wrapped around his head. 

His own hands touched the wrapping and he frowned. 

The woman furrowed her brows. "I think it's time to visit the healer again." 

Before Nine could stop her, she picked him up like he weighed nothing, tucked his head against the crook of her neck, and left the hut.

What the hell is happening?

---

The healer lived on a busy street. 

Nine knew this because he and the woman had passed several market stalls and shopfronts and there were what looked to be hundreds of people wandering around the area. 

While the woman carried him, he noticed the rural buildings and unfamiliar architecture reminiscent of the Great Void, a period historians knew little about and was only known to have existed a thousand years before the ancient Empire of Rhine.

"..."  

Fuck. 

He was a time-traveling body snatcher. 

The healer's clinic was situated in a small building at the very end of the street. 

The woman knocked on the door a couple of times.
